We report four cases in which a pericardium (Tutoplast) plug was used to repair a corneoscleral fistula after Ahmed Glaucoma Valve (AGV) explantation. In four cases in which the AGV tube had been exposed, AGV explantation was performed using a pericardium (Tutoplast) plug to seal the defect previously occupied by the tube. This paper investigates an improved genetic algorithm on multiple automated guided vehicle (multi-AGV) path planning. The innovations embody in two aspects. First, three-exchange crossover heuristic operators are used to produce more optimal offsprings for getting more information than with the traditional two-exchange crossover heuristic operators in the improved genetic algorithm. The Automated Guided Vehicles (or AGVs for short) have become an important option in the container handling process. We present a parallel simulation system for the study of AGV routing schemes. We model the AGV system based on a time-driven approach and execute the model on an efficient simulation engine implemented by using Cilk, a parallel programming language developed at MIT. PURPOSE To compare the success rates, complications, and visual outcomes between silicone Ahmed glaucoma valve (AGV) implantation with 96 mm(2) (FP8) or 184 mm(2) (FP7) surface areas. METHODS This study is a retrospective review of the records from 132 adult patients (134 eyes) that underwent silicone AGV implant surgery. This paper presents a multi-objective genetic algorithm (MOGA) with Pareto optimality and elitist tactics for the control system design of automated guided vehicle (AGV). The MOGA is used to identify AGV driving system model and optimize its servo control system sequentially.
